Alena Kovačková’s run at the tournament in Paris concluded in the semifinals, where she was defeated by Ekaterina Oktiabreva. The result secures a spot in the final for Oktiabreva, who will now compete for the championship title in the French capital.
Semifinal Results and Tournament Progression
The match, which served as a penultimate hurdle for both players, saw Oktiabreva emerge victorious in a closely contested battle. For Kovačková, the loss marks the end of her advancement in the draw, while Oktiabreva moves forward to the final round.
